I'm still switching between the 2 to see what I like better, at least around town, but am primarily running map2 I would say. Also after having seat time with both maps now, I wouldn't say map 1 is necessarily stronger under partial throttle, it just takes much less throttle input to target higher boost. It gives it a much more "flash tune" type of feel. Different styles of driving for each map.

I also wouldn't say map 2 feels like stock, just the boost build-up is stock like, as opposed to surgey on map 1.

WOT between the 2 is no comparison. Map 2 is a freaking beast! I was giving it some WOT in 2nd and 3rd gear and no matter where I put my phone to monitor the gauges it would fly out of position from the torque lol.

Map 2 is probably the smoother of the 2. But map 1 does give better turbo sounds in my opinion. I say just mess around with them and see what you like. Make sure you have a DP if you're running 2 though.

As for firmware:
I was on 10, which is what it came with. Then switched to 9, which felt the same as 10 so switched back to 10. Then terry gave me 11 to try which just allows you to turn the map 1 feature off if desired, otherwise its the same as 10. So technically im on FW11, but its essentially the exact same as FW10

I also don't believe I feel any hesitation on map 1 on FW10, personally. At least nothing has stood out to me.
